An oxygen sensor spacer is created to modify the placement of the oxygen sensor within the exhaust system. By transferring the sensor further away from the main flow of exhaust gases, the spacer can assist stop the sensor from obtaining an erroneous reading due to varying temperatures and pressures present in high-performance exhaust setups. This is especially helpful for customers who have set up aftermarket catalytic converters and exhaust headers. The spacer produces a physical barrier that not only changes the sensor's positioning yet can also help in reducing the velocity of gases passing over the sensor, enabling it to provide more steady readings.

One might wonder whether installing an O2 sensor spacer is a modification that any driver should take into consideration. The brief solution is that it mainly relies on the specifics of the lorry and the alterations that have actually been made. Normally, vehicles that have undergone substantial exhaust alterations might gain from making use of a spacer. As an example, if you've changed your manufacturing facility catalytic converter with a high-flow alternative or eliminated it completely, the O2 sensor may no more be placed efficiently to gauge the exhaust circulation properly. In these scenarios, an oxygen sensor spacer can be a sensible option to guarantee that the engine remains to receive precise information for ideal functioning.
